Complete snapshot of /opt/microdao-daarion/ from NODE1 (144.76.224.179).
This represents the actual running production code that has diverged
significantly from the previous main branch.
Key changes from old main:
- Gateway (http_api.py): expanded from ~40KB to 164KB with full agent support
- Router: new /v1/agents/{id}/infer endpoint with vision + DeepSeek routing
- Behavior Policy: SOWA v2.2 (3-level: FULL/ACK/SILENT)
- Agent Registry: config/agent_registry.yml as single source of truth
- 13 agents configured (was 3)
- Memory service integration
- CrewAI teams and roles
Excluded from snapshot: venv/, .env, data/, backups, .tgz archives
Co-authored-by: Cursor <cursoragent@cursor.com>
3.9 KiB
3.9 KiB
Aletheia Lab OS — Документація
Огляд
Aletheia (Алетейя) — міждисциплінарний дослідницький агент та операційна система лабораторії в екосистемі DAARION.
Над-мета: "Міст між епохами" — виявляти приховану істину та пропонувати рішення, що спрощують та гармонізують.
Ментор
Олександр Вертій "Алвєр"
- Telegram: @archenvis
- Email: alverjob@gmail.com
- Сайт: https://alverjob.xyz
- YouTube: https://www.youtube.com/@alverjob72
Робочі канали:
- Канал: https://t.me/alverjob
- Чат: https://t.me/alverjob_chat
Архітектура
Режими автономності
| Режим | Опис | Дозволи |
|---|---|---|
| A0 | Advisory only | Тільки консультації, без зовнішніх дій |
| A1 | Assisted | Зовнішні дії після підтвердження користувача |
| A2 | Controlled autonomy | Автономні дії в межах BudgetPolicy |
Субагенти (CrewAI "professors")
- Prof-Erudite — пошук, верифікація, аналогії
- Prof-Analyst — декомпозиція, TRIZ, формалізація
- Prof-Creative — латеральні ідеї, провокації
- Prof-Optimizer — реалізовність, мінімальність
- Prof-Communicator — синтез, комунікація
JSON-схеми
Розташування: /opt/microdao-daarion/schemas/aletheia/
| Схема | Призначення |
|---|---|
intent.schema.json |
Внутрішнє представлення наміру |
action.schema.json |
Зовнішня дія з Policy Gate |
ledger_entry.schema.json |
Запис в журнал аудиту |
budget_policy.schema.json |
Політика бюджету та дозволів |
Core Loop
1. Interpret → Intent JSON
2. Clarify → Уточнення (1-3 питання)
3. Plan → План + очікувані виходи
4. Delegate → Запити до субагентів
5. Decide → Відповідь / Action JSON
6. Log → LedgerEntry (для зовнішніх дій)
7. Reflect → Оновлення евристик
Policy Gate
Кожна зовнішня дія перевіряється на:
- clarity_ok — чіткість наміру
- risk_ok — прийнятний рівень ризику
- budget_ok — відповідність бюджету
- permission_ok — дозволи режиму
- target_ok — валідна ціль
- privacy_ok — захист приватності
- rate_limit_ok — в межах лімітів
- logging_ok — можливість аудиту
Multimodal
- Фото: vision-моделі, OCR, технічні креслення
- Документи: PDF, DOCX, Excel → RAG
- Голос: STT вже інтегровано
Інтеграції
- DAARWIZZ: Координація R&D задач
- DAARION: Memory Service, Router, NATS
- Helion: Спільні енергетичні дослідження
- Nutra: Колаборація по біотех
Приклад використання
Запит: "Оптимізувати процес екстракції"
Aletheia:
- Стабілізує запит (уточнює що/як/критерії)
- Залучає Prof-Analyst для TRIZ-аналізу
- Залучає Prof-Creative для альтернатив
- Prof-Optimizer оцінює реалізовність
- Prof-Communicator формує відповідь
Версія: 2.0 | Дата: 2026-01-28